What does the role require?




  • Serve as the primary sponsor contact, communicate key study updates, and ensure alignment among sponsors, Bright leadership, and study team members.


  • Direct team members on timelines, strategies, and study activities; develop and manage protocols, plans, and study documents; ensure accurate, timely study reporting.


  • Work with sponsors and site personnel to identify, qualify, select, initiate, and train study sites; collaborate with Clinical Research Associate (CRAs) to resolve monitoring findings.


  • Ensure adherence to protocols, Good Clinical Practice (GCPs), regulatory requirements, IRB/EC standards, and internal procedures; identify and mitigate study risks; support audits and inspections.


  • Coordinate with departments such as Data Management and Regulatory; manage activities with third-party vendors (e.g., translation services, core labs); facilitate or assist with investigator, committee, and study team meetings.


  • Provide training and guidance to entry-level team members and participate in staff and project team meetings as needed.
